1997 Land Rover Discovery service brakes, hydraulic problems
12 owner complaints filed with NHTSA name the service brakes, hydraulic on the 1997 Land Rover Discovery — 34% of all complaints for this model year.
What owners report
“Surging at fully closed throttle accompanied by abs failure is a real issue with this vehicle. This is a common problem acknowledged by the manufacturer. Prm chip replacement to fix the surge problem should be a safety recall. My 1997 land rover discovery would not stop at a stop light when letting…”
filed Jul 20, 2004
“Brakes frequently fail to stop vehicle at speeds under 20mph. Dealer stated it was a bad abs sensor on right front wheel. It was replaced at a cost of $500.00 but the problem remained. I see from internet postings it is a common problem in '97 discoveries. The real hazard is that it does not matter…”
filed Jul 8, 2002
Verbatim excerpts from complaints filed with NHTSA. Reports are not independently verified.
